3-十二烷氧基-2-羟基丙基三甲基氯化铵的合成及性质研究

摘    要:本文以十二醇、环氧氯丙烷(EPIC)与三甲胺盐酸盐合成了阳离子表面活性剂3-十二烷氧基-2-羟基丙基三甲基氯化铵(DPAC)。实验得出了最佳合成条件:中间体十二烷基缩水甘油醚:n(脂肪醇)∶n(EPIC)=1∶1.8,反应时间4 h,温度50℃,碱的浓度为50%,四丁基溴化铵作催化剂;DPAC的合成:n(十二烷氧基缩水甘油醚)∶n(三甲胺盐酸盐)=1∶1,温度30℃,反应3 h。DPAC的收率可达96%。使用红外、核磁共振对产品进行了定性分析,并研究了其界面、抗菌、抑菌性质。

关 键 词:脂肪醇  季铵盐  阳离子表面活性剂  相转移催化

Studies on Synthesis and Surfactivities of 3-Dodecoxyl-2-Hydroxypropyl Trimethyl Ammonium Chloride

Abstract:This paper takes epichlorohydrine (EPIC) and the lauryl alcohol as a raw material, synthesized the active intermediate lauryl glycidol ether; then responses with trimethylamine muriate, producting high-quality mellow positive ion glycerine ether sunface active agent 3- dodecoxyl-2-hydroxyl propyl trimethyl ammonium chloride (DPAC). The most superior synthetic condition of lauryl glycidol ether: n (lauryl alcohol): n (EPIC) = 1 : 1. 8, the reaction time is 4 hours, temperature is 50℃, the alkali density is 50%, four butyl ammonium bromide as the catalyst. The most superior synthetic technological condition of DPAC: n (dodecane oxygen radical glycidol ether): n (trimethylamine muriate) =1 : 1, the reaction temperature is 30℃, the reaction time is 3 hours, the yield of DPAC is 96M. The structure of the product was characterized by IR. HNMR. And the interface and antibacterial character of DPAC are studied.
Keywords:fatty alcohol  quaternary ammonium salt  surfactant  phase transfer catalysis
